1樓:匿名使用者
虛擬儲存器的概念 為解決記憶體小而作業大、作業多的矛盾, 以及執行過程中只是把當前執行需要的那部分程式和資料裝入記憶體。 所以,作業系統把各級儲存器統一管理起來。
就是說, 應該把一個程式當前正在使用的部分放在記憶體, 而其餘部分放在磁碟上,就啟動執行它。
作業系統根據程式執行時的要求和記憶體的實際使用情況, 隨機地對每個程式進行換入/換出。 這樣, 就給使用者提供一個比正式的記憶體空間大的多的地址空間, 這就是虛擬儲存器。
所謂虛擬儲存器是使用者能作為可編址記憶體對待的儲存空間, 在這種計算機系統中虛地址被對映成實地址。
簡單地說,虛擬儲存器:是由作業系統提供的一個假想的特大儲存器。
就是說, 虛擬儲存器並不是實際的記憶體,它的大小比記憶體空間大的多;
使用者感覺所能使用的「記憶體」非常大, 但這是作業系統對實體記憶體的擴充。 它的物質基礎是:
二級儲存器結構、和動態地址轉換(dat)。
機構虛擬儲存器的基本特徵:
虛擬擴充。 虛擬儲存器不是物理上擴充記憶體空間, 而是邏輯上擴充了記憶體容量。 部分裝入。
每個作業不是全部一次的裝入記憶體, 而是分成若干部分。 離散分配。 一個作業分成多個部分,沒有全部裝入記憶體。
即使裝入記憶體的那些部分也不必佔用連續的記憶體空間, 而是「見縫插針」。 多次對換。
在一個程序執行期間, 它所需的全部程式和數就要分成多次調入記憶體。
注意:虛擬儲存器的容量雖然提供了特大的地址空間, 使用者在程式設計時一般不應考慮可用空間有多大。 但是, 虛擬儲存器的容量不是無限大的。
它主要受兩方面的限制:
(1)機器指令中表示地址的二進位制數是有限的;
(2)外存的容量也是有限的。
2樓:麻樂隔壁的
儲存虛擬化,把不同的硬體抽象出來,以管理工具來實現統一的管理,不必再管後端的介質到底是什麼。
什麼是虛擬儲存器?它的原理是是什麼?
3樓:墨汁諾
虛擬儲存器的概念為解決記憶體小而作業大、作業多的矛盾,以及執行過程中只是把當前執行需要的那部分程式和資料裝入記憶體。
如該組號已在主存內,則轉而執行;如果該組號不在主存內,則檢查主存中是否有空閒區,如果沒有,便將某個暫時不用的組調出送往輔存,以便將這組資訊調入主存。
虛擬儲存器源出於英國atlas計算機的一級儲存器概念。這種系統的主存為16千字的磁芯儲存器,但**處理器可用20位邏輯地址對主存定址。到2023年,美國rca公司研究成功虛擬儲存器系統。
ibm公司於2023年在ibm370系統上全面採用了虛擬儲存技術。虛擬儲存器已成為計算機系統中非常重要的部分。
4樓:暴走少女
虛擬記憶體是計算機系統記憶體管理的一種技術。它使得應用程式認為它擁有連續的可用的記憶體(一個連續完整的地址空間),而實際上,它通常是被分隔成多個實體記憶體碎片,還有部分暫時儲存在外部磁碟儲存器上,在需要時進行資料交換。
原理:①**處理器訪問主存的邏輯地址分解成組號a和組內地址b,並對組號a進行地址變換,即將邏輯組號a作為索引,查地址變換表,以確定該組資訊是否存放在主存內。
②如該組號已在主存內,則轉而執行;如果該組號不在主存內,則檢查主存中是否有空閒區,如果沒有,便將某個暫時不用的組調出送往輔存,以便將這組資訊調入主存。
③從輔存讀出所要的組,並送到主存空閒區,然後將那個空閒的物理組號a和邏輯組號a登入在地址變換表中。
④從地址變換表讀出與邏輯組號a對應的物理組號a。
⑤從物理組號a和組內位元組地址b得到實體地址。
⑥根據實體地址從主存中存取必要的資訊。
什麼是虛擬儲存器?它的原理是是什麼
5樓:六鴻卓
虛擬記憶體別稱虛擬儲存器(virtual memory),是計算機系統記憶體管理的一種技術。它使得應用程式認為它擁有連續的可用的記憶體(一個連續完整的地址空間)。
工作原理:
虛擬儲存器是由硬體和作業系統自動實現儲存資訊排程和管理的。它的工作過程包括6個步驟: [3]
①**處理器訪問主存的邏輯地址分解成組號a和組內地址b,並對組號a進行地址變換,即將邏輯組號a作為索引,查地址變換表,以確定該組資訊是否存放在主存內。
②如該組號已在主存內,則轉而執行;如果該組號不在主存內,則檢查主存中是否有空閒區,如果沒有,便將某個暫時不用的組調出送往輔存,以便將這組資訊調入主存。
③從輔存讀出所要的組,並送到主存空閒區,然後將那個空閒的物理組號a和邏輯組號a登入在地址變換表中。
④從地址變換表讀出與邏輯組號a對應的物理組號a。
⑤從物理組號a和組內位元組地址b得到實體地址。
⑥根據實體地址從主存中存取必要的資訊。
6樓:巴巴拉小白兔
虛擬儲存器別稱虛擬記憶體。是計算機系統記憶體管理的一種技術。它使得應用程式認為它擁有連續的可用的記憶體(一個連續完整的地址空間),而實際上,它通常是被分隔成多個實體記憶體碎片,還有部分暫時儲存在外部磁碟儲存器上,在需要時進行資料交換。
虛擬記憶體是windows 為作為記憶體使用的一部分硬碟空間。虛擬記憶體在硬碟上其實就是為一個碩大無比的檔案,檔名是pagefile.sys,通常狀態下是看不到的。
必須關閉資源管理器對系統檔案的保護功能才能看到這個檔案。虛擬記憶體有時候也被稱為是「頁面檔案」就是從這個檔案的檔名中來的。
擴充套件資料
工作原理
虛擬儲存器是由硬體和作業系統自動實現儲存資訊排程和管理的。
1、**處理器訪問主存的邏輯地址分解成組號a和組內地址b,並對組號a進行地址變換,即將邏輯組號a作為索引,查地址變換表,以確定該組資訊是否存放在主存內。
2、如該組號已在主存內,則轉而執行;如果該組號不在主存內,則檢查主存中是否有空閒區,如果沒有,便將某個暫時不用的組調出送往輔存,以便將這組資訊調入主存。
3、從輔存讀出所要的組,並送到主存空閒區,然後將那個空閒的物理組號a和邏輯組號a登入在地址變換表中。
4、從地址變換表讀出與邏輯組號a對應的物理組號a。
6、從物理組號a和組內位元組地址b得到實體地址。
7、根據實體地址從主存中存取必要的資訊。
7樓:匿名使用者
介紹:虛擬記憶體別稱虛擬儲存器(virtual memory)。電腦中所執行的程式均需經由記憶體執行,若執行的程式佔用記憶體很大或很多,則會導致記憶體消耗殆盡。
為解決該問題,windows中運用了虛擬記憶體技術,即勻出一部分硬碟空間來充當記憶體使用。當記憶體耗盡時,電腦就會自動呼叫硬碟來充當記憶體,以緩解記憶體的緊張。若計算機執行程式或操作所需的隨機儲存器(ram)不足時,則 windows 會用虛擬儲存器進行補償。
它將計算機的ram和硬碟上的臨時空間組合。當ram執行速率緩慢時,它便將資料從ram移動到稱為「分頁檔案」的空間中。將資料移入分頁檔案可釋放ram,以便完成工作。
一般而言,計算機的ram容量越大,程式執行得越快。若計算機的速率由於ram可用空間匱乏而減緩,則可嘗試通過增加虛擬記憶體來進行補償。但是,計算機從ram讀取資料的速率要比從硬碟讀取資料的速率快,因而擴增ram容量(可加記憶體條)是最佳選擇。
虛擬記憶體是windows 為作為記憶體使用的一部分硬碟空間。虛擬記憶體在硬碟上其實就是為一個碩大無比的檔案,檔名是pagefile.sys,通常狀態下是看不到的。
必須關閉資源管理器對系統檔案的保護功能才能看到這個檔案。虛擬記憶體有時候也被稱為是「頁面檔案」就是從這個檔案的檔名中來的。
記憶體在計算機中的作用很大,電腦中所有執行的程式都需要經過記憶體來執行,如果執行的程式很大或很多,就會導致記憶體消耗殆盡。為了解決這個問題,windows運用了虛擬記憶體技術,即拿出一部分硬碟空間來充當記憶體使用,這部分空間即稱為虛擬記憶體,虛擬記憶體在硬碟上的存在形式就是 pagefile.sys這個頁面檔案。
原理:虛擬儲存器是由硬體和作業系統自動實現儲存資訊排程和管理的。它的工作過程包括6個步驟:
①**處理器訪問主存的邏輯地址分解成組號a和組內地址b,並對組號a進行地址變換,即將邏輯組號a作為索引,查地址變換表,以確定該組資訊是否存放在主存內。
②如該組號已在主存內,則轉而執行④;如果該組號不在主存內,則檢查主存中是否有空閒區,如果沒有,便將某個暫時不用的組調出送往輔存,以便將這組資訊調入主存。
③從輔存讀出所要的組,並送到主存空閒區,然後將那個空閒的物理組號a和邏輯組號a登入在地址變換表中。
④從地址變換表讀出與邏輯組號a對應的物理組號a。
⑤從物理組號a和組內位元組地址b得到實體地址。
⑥根據實體地址從主存中存取必要的資訊。
排程方式有分頁式、段式、段頁式3種。頁式排程是將邏輯和實體地址空間都分成固定大小的頁。主存按頁順序編號,而每個獨立編址的程式空間有自己的頁號順序,通過排程輔存中程式的各頁可以離散裝入主存中不同的頁面位置,並可據表一一對應檢索。
頁式排程的優點是頁內零頭小,頁表對程式設計師來說是透明的,地址變換快,調入操作簡單;缺點是各頁不是程式的獨立模組,不便於實現程式和資料的保護。段式排程是按程式的邏輯結構劃分地址空間,段的長度是隨意的,並且允許伸長,它的優點是消除了記憶體零頭,易於實現儲存保護,便於程式動態裝配;缺點是調入操作複雜。將這兩種方法結合起來便構成段頁式排程。
在段頁式排程中把物理空間分成頁,程式按模組分段,每個段再分成與物理空間頁同樣小的頁面。段頁式排程綜合了段式和頁式的優點。其缺點是增加了硬體成本,軟體也較複雜。
大型通用計算機系統多數採用段頁式排程。
虛擬儲存器的基本原理是什麼?其容量主要受到什麼限制?
8樓:匿名使用者
虛擬儲存器的基本特徵是:
①虛擬擴充,即不是物理上而是邏輯上擴充了記憶體容量;
②部分裝入,即每個作業不是全部一次性地裝入記憶體,而是隻裝入一部分;
③離散分配,即不必佔用連續的記憶體空間,而是"見縫插針";
④多次對換,即所需的全部程式和資料要分成多次調入記憶體.
虛擬儲存器的容量主要受到指令中表示地址的字長和外存的容量的限制.
9樓:梧桐墜
利用大容量的外存空間來邏輯擴充記憶體;
受計算機匯流排地址結構限制.
話術的基本原理是什麼
學語言就像學英文會話 最近有一則學英文的廣告 當老外問路說 臺北車站怎麼走 老中的頭腦馬上出現學生時代為應付所學的文法,然後七想八想一句話也講不出來!你在學推銷的過程是否也有同樣的遭遇呢?以前我學英文會話也有同樣的經驗,後來在生活中有機會與英語系的外國人接觸,從接機 用餐到討論合作細節,單詞一個字一...
開關電源的基本原理是什麼
開關電源原理抄 開關電源實質就襲是一個 振盪電路bai,du這種轉換電能的方式,zhi不僅應dao用在電源電路,在其它的電路應用也很普遍,如液晶顯示器的背光電路 日光燈等。開關源與變壓器相比具有效率高 穩性好 體積小等優點,缺點是功率相對較小,而且會對電路產生高頻干擾,電路複雜不易維修等。開關電源的...
刮痧的基本概念和基本原理是什麼
現代刮痧 以中醫臟腑經絡學說為理論指導,博採鍼灸 按摩 點穴 拔罐等中醫非藥物 之所長,所用工具是水牛角為材料製做的刮痧板,對人體具有活血化瘀 調整陰陽或舒筋通絡 排除毒素等作用,是既可保健又可 的一種自然 刮痧的作用原理 1 調整陰陽刮痧對內臟功能有明顯的調整陰陽平衡的作用,如腸蠕動亢進者,在腹部...